Rugged Tablet Market (USD Million)
Rugged Tablet Market was valued at USD 870.40 million in the year 2024. The size of this market is expected to increase to USD 1,291.58 million by the year 2031, while growing at a Compounded Annual Growth Rate (CAGR) of 5.8%.

Rugged Tablet Market, Segmentation by Type
The Rugged Tablet Market is segmented by Type into Fully Rugged and Semi Rugged. Each category caters to varying environmental demands and operational durability standards based on shock resistance, ingress protection (IP) rating, and performance endurance.
Fully Rugged
Fully Rugged Tablets are designed for extreme environments and harsh industrial conditions. They offer high resistance to vibration, dust, and water, often compliant with MIL-STD-810G and IP65+ certifications. Used extensively in defense, mining, oil & gas, and heavy manufacturing, these tablets ensure uninterrupted operation even under severe conditions.
Semi Rugged
Semi Rugged Tablets provide a balance between durability and affordability. They are ideal for retail, education, and logistics applications where occasional exposure to rough handling occurs. Enhanced designs with reinforced casings and spill-resistant screens are expanding their market adoption across light industrial environments.

Rugged Tablet Market, Segmentation by End Use Industry
The Rugged Tablet Market is segmented by End Use Industry into Oil & Gas, Retail, Construction, Education, Government, Food & Beverage, Manufacturing, Healthcare, Transportation & Logistics, and Others. Increasing field digitization, workforce mobility, and real-time data access are fueling adoption across all verticals.
Oil & Gas
Oil & Gas companies use rugged tablets for asset inspection, site monitoring, and field data recording. Their resistance to temperature extremes, vibrations, and hazardous conditions makes them indispensable in exploration and refinery operations.
Retail
Retail applications include inventory tracking, POS operations, and in-store analytics. Rugged tablets enhance mobility, customer engagement, and efficiency in dynamic retail environments, particularly in warehouses and outdoor sales zones.
Construction
Construction firms employ rugged tablets for on-site inspections, project management, and real-time coordination. Devices with dustproof and impact-resistant designs are essential for maintaining operational continuity across large construction sites.
Education
Education institutions adopt rugged tablets for digital classrooms, STEM training, and field-based learning. Their durable structure ensures longevity and lower maintenance costs, supporting expanding digital learning initiatives.
Government
Government agencies utilize rugged tablets for public safety, defense, and disaster management. Integration with GIS, GPS, and data collection applications enhances responsiveness and operational coordination.
Food & Beverage
Food & Beverage industries leverage rugged tablets for quality control, production tracking, and warehouse operations. Their sealed, sanitary designs make them ideal for use in wet or contamination-sensitive environments.
Manufacturing
Manufacturing facilities depend on rugged tablets for equipment monitoring, workflow optimization, and maintenance logging. Integration with industrial IoT systems enables predictive maintenance and improved production efficiency.
Healthcare
Healthcare providers employ rugged tablets for electronic health records (EHR) management, patient tracking, and diagnostic data entry. The growing emphasis on infection-resistant, antimicrobial-coated devices supports rising adoption across hospitals and clinics.
Transportation & Logistics
Transportation & Logistics industries use rugged tablets for fleet management, route optimization, and shipment tracking. Their ability to withstand vibration, temperature variation, and outdoor exposure ensures reliability in high-mobility environments.
Others
The Others category includes agriculture, utilities, and field service sectors that utilize rugged tablets for remote data entry, monitoring, and communication. Increasing focus on connected operations and field automation is expanding use cases in these industries.

Advancements in rugged tablet technology- Advancements in rugged tablet technology have become a key driver in industries such as construction, military, field services, and logistics, where reliability and durability in harsh environments are crucial. These advancements have focused on improving the physical design, ensuring that rugged tablets are not only resistant to extreme conditions like dust, water, and drops but also capable of functioning in diverse temperature ranges. Enhanced shock resistance, IP ratings (Ingress Protection), and military-grade certifications (such as MIL-STD-810G) have allowed these devices to withstand demanding environments that traditional tablets cannot.
Another significant factor driving advancements is the improvement in display technology. Rugged tablets now come with high-resolution, sunlight-readable screens, allowing users to operate them in outdoor environments without compromising visibility. Innovations like glove-compatible touchscreens and anti-reflective coatings also enhance usability in challenging fieldwork scenarios, making these devices more user-friendly while maintaining their durability. These displays not only serve as a practical solution but also improve user efficiency in complex operations.
Performance improvements in processing power and battery life are also major contributors. Rugged tablets are being equipped with more powerful processors, allowing for faster performance and the capability to run demanding software applications. Coupled with these advancements, manufacturers are focusing on extending battery life, allowing these tablets to function for extended hours without requiring frequent recharges. This makes rugged tablets more reliable for fieldworkers who often operate in remote locations where charging facilities are limited.

Rising demand for rugged tablets in healthcare and logistics- The rising demand for rugged tablets in healthcare and logistics presents significant opportunities for companies in these sectors, driven by the increasing need for efficient, durable, and versatile devices. In healthcare, rugged tablets provide healthcare professionals with a portable and reliable tool for patient data management, enabling real-time access to electronic health records (EHR) and telemedicine platforms. These devices can withstand the challenging environments of hospitals, clinics, and other healthcare settings, where frequent sanitization, spills, and drops are common. As healthcare continues to adopt digital technologies, the demand for rugged tablets capable of functioning in these environments is expected to grow.
The logistics industry has seen a shift towards mobility and automation, where rugged tablets play a crucial role in streamlining operations. These devices are well-suited for warehouse management, inventory tracking, and route optimization, all of which are essential components of modern logistics. With the need for efficient and uninterrupted operations in warehouses, transport vehicles, and distribution centers, rugged tablets offer a solution that ensures both durability and functionality. Their ability to withstand extreme temperatures, dust, and water exposure makes them a reliable choice for logistics companies that operate in tough conditions.
The increasing trend of IoT (Internet of Things) adoption in both healthcare and logistics is driving the demand for rugged tablets. These devices act as a hub for connecting various IoT devices, allowing seamless data exchange, monitoring, and control. For instance, in healthcare, rugged tablets can integrate with medical devices such as infusion pumps, diagnostic machines, and wearable health monitors to provide healthcare workers with real-time data. In logistics, they can be used to monitor the condition of goods during transit, providing critical insights into temperature, humidity, and other factors that could affect the quality and safety of products.
